> You should look at the documentation for
> TypeModule<http://valadoc.org/references/gobject-2.0/0.11.5/GLib.TypeModule.html>.
> Basically you subclass this, and implement the load/unload methods to use
> Module <http://valadoc.org/references/gmodule-2.0/0.11.5/GLib.Module.html>.
> In the load method you construct Module, and in unload you assign null to
> the member referencing it, causing an unref and deletion. That in turn
> unloads the actual code.

I'm wondering if it isn't better to just use libpeas. Unless you need
something special or don't want to depend on an external library, it is
IMHO better to use something already there than reinventing the wheel.
